About Alan Filreis

Alan Filreis is a scholar working on Literature and Literary Theory, Sociology and Political Science and Infectious Diseases, having authored 15 papers that have together received 62 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Poetry Analysis and Criticism (13 papers), French Literature and Poetry (8 papers) and Modernist Literature and Criticism (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Literature and Literary Theory (49 citations), Music (4 citations) and Visual Arts and Performing Arts (6 citations). Alan Filreis has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Charles E.H. Berger, Wallace Stevens, Glen MacLeod, Alan M. Wald, Ellen Schrecker, Brian McHale, Walter Kalaidjian, Thomas J. Sugrue, Bonnie Costello and James Longenbach. Their work appears in journals such as Poetics Today, American Literature and American Quarterly.
